On December 28, 1993, days after Ashu was paraded in handcuffs in his locality[25], Ruchika consumed poison. She died the next day. Rathore threw a party that night to celebrate. [37]
Rathore refused to release Ruchika's body to her father Subash unless he signed blank sheets of paper. The blank papers were later used by the police to establish that the family had accepted Ruchika's forged autopsy report. [38] Rathore also threatened to kill Ashu, who was still in illegal police custody. [24] At this time, Ashu was allegedly unconscious in CIA lock-up. He had been stripped naked and beaten the previous night by drunk policemen. He was brought back to his house, still unconscious, after Ruchika's last rites were over.[30][29]
In the inquest and the postmortem report, the name Ruchika was replaced with her nickname Ruby, and her father's name was changed to Subhash Chander Khatri.[39] This was to ensure that anyone reading the report would not know it pertains to Ruchika.[40]
The government closed the case filed against Rathore less than a week after her death.[41]
Unable to bear the harassment, her family moved out of Chandigarh.[2]
Just a few months later, Rathore was promoted to additional DGP in November 1994, when Bhajan Lal was chief minister. [18]
